“Old Jack Big Ute”

“Old Jack Big Ute” was referred to in a family history book about the Garner family, including Phillip Garner and Mary Hedrick, who had a farm in Burch Creek, Ogden. Since there are mentions in other settler stories of separate men known as Big Ute and Indian Jack, the reference here may be a miscommunication about those two men. Or it may be a single person here.
